小弟根深蒂固的觀念是寫程式的時候,一舉一動操作都和指標、記憶體、甚至little/big E
ndian習習相關,call個function也要有感覺arguments在push,stack memory在深陷,stac
k pointer在運動,才不會發生嚴重錯誤;
故程式設計的基礎觀念應在coding 時於血脈中流竄,伴隨鍵盤喀喀的節奏在鼓動,搭配不
停地iteratively檢查操作的正確性來回來回進進出出push pop in in out out;
但有時聽到有些論點認為業界經驗比較重要而凌駕於基礎學養之上,我承認use model或設
計經驗也是一門學問,需要時間累積,但仍堅持考卷上基礎的題目是coding的基石,唯有建
立在此穩固的基礎上才不會動輒得咎,bug滿天飛。
想請教版友我是不是錯了,是不是錯得離譜,錯得六親不認錯得滿門抄斬!?
先感謝同行前輩分享看法和經驗,德不孤必有鄰。